Saints rookie QB Tyler Shough proves he can do what Derek Carr never seemed to in New Orleans during the offseason

   

Tyler Shough was Kellen Moore and the New Orleans Saints' guy in the 2025 NFL Draft class. They selected him with the 40th overall selection, and he's knee-deep in a quarterback competition for Moore's offense. Spencer Rattler is the other QB in contention for the job as of now.

Shough is putting in some notable extra work with his receivers, according to recent reports. 

Tyler Shough's offseason workouts could pay off

The rookie recently noted that he has been planning to work out with Saints receivers during the slow portion of the offseason ahead of training camp for New Orleans. That has come to fruition, as Shough, along with other QBs, worked with wideouts earlier this week in Beaverton. 

Brandin Cooks has bought in, considering his involvement here. It would be easy for the veteran wide receiver to take this time off, but he is putting work in with the first-year QB instead. 

“For me, I know the window of opportunity is only so big for anybody,” Shough said. “You have to come in and be prepared. Now that we’ve got the playbook installed … I just want to continue to grow and then attack training camp. -- Tyler Shough via Matthew Paras

 

Shough is clearly determined to develop strong relationships with his pass catchers, and even offensive lineman - like Cesar Ruiz - have taken notice of his talent and work ethic. 

Derek Carr's time in New Orleans

Carr's tenure with the Saints was not a preferable one when it came to the fan base. Carr felt a bit disconnected throughout his time in New Orleans, and that became clear early on. 

Many fans felt like Carr did not fully appreciate the city he was playing in, and they also thought he did not consistently take blame when necessary. Teammates got visually frustrated with the veteran quarterback at times, but it was always seemingly pushed under the rug. 

Meanwhile, Carr had multiple outbursts in game side to frustration that were met with ridicule from fans. The offseason never seemed to have these sort of optional workouts between Carr and his pass catchers. The young QB in New Orleans now is changing that sort of narrative as the potential starter. 

Shough's move as a rookie to value his relationships with his teammates, young and old, could be extremely refreshing for his fan base. We will see if that training helps him land the starting role for Kellen Moore's offense this season.
